Trompe l’oeil of a “drawing” on a wooden background
Pencil, watercolour, 126 x 101 mm
Provenance: private collection, The Netherlands
*
An amusing trompe l’oeil “drawing” of a mother and child talking to a man in a landscape, illusionistically “mounted” with red lacquer on a background of wooden planks. The sheet seems to date from around 1780-1800 and could have been made either in France, Germany or Holland, presumably in France. Very charming drawing in good condition.
